Section 5603.

CA Govt Code § 5603 (2016) What's This?

5603. Any provision of law specifying the maximum or minimum denomination of bonds to the contrary notwithstanding, a governing body in its ordinance, resolution or order providing for the issuance of any bonds may provide that such bonds shall be issued in a denomination or denominations of any amount or amounts prescribed by it. All bonds of an issue or series of bonds need not be of the same denomination.

(Added by Stats. 1963, Ch. 736.)
